I started by seeing how much of the tub lid I was going to need to make the Grow pods support plate.



When I cut it out I used my knife. I found that scoring a few shallow cuts then flexing the plastic made it a cut much more easily.
Next I used a bit of soda bottle to mark the holes in the frame plate. I made sure to size the holes to fit the middle of the 24 oz bottles that are going to be my grow pods, I cut the ends off past the little lip so it will res on that one its in the frame plate. againI cut small and worked it a little at a time till I got the size right.


All right pods in I just pushed them through the hole it crushed in the tapered bit by the caps but it won’t matter.
Now to the Ebb/Flow lines and the drip tubes for the other 2 bigger grow pods.



Ok the epoxy. I made a few mistakes here I got the fast acting one for plastics, not the water proof one as it was $2 cheaper. I mixed way to much the first time by the time I did 2 lines it was hardening, mixing just enough for 1 at a time worked ok but take a look you can tell this is not going to work.



Well afeter a few hours to let the epoxy set and its time for ver 0.2’s first test…

… Results:Epic failure it make bubbles and drips a bit.
